Veranda Sealing Questions
What is veranda sealing? Veranda sealing involves applying a protective coating to preserve the wood, prevent moisture damage, and extend the lifespan of the structure.
What types of verandas benefit from sealing? Both new and older verandas made of wood or composite materials can benefit from sealing to maintain appearance and durability.
How often should a veranda be sealed? Typically, sealing is recommended every 1 to 3 years, depending on weather exposure and material type.
What are common signs that a veranda needs sealing? Fading, surface roughness, or water absorption are signs that the veranda may require sealing to protect against damage.
